If you want to see the buffers and cache memory separately, then run the free command with the -w option as follows: free -w As you can see, the buffers and cache memory usage information is shown in different columns. By default, the free command shows the buffers and cache memory usage in the buff/cache column. There are a few different options that you can use with the free command. To use this command, simply type free at the command prompt. This command displays a summary of the system’s memory usage, including information on total, used, and free memory. Display basic memory usage information using free in human readable format. The free command is probably the most popular way to check memory size in Linux.
